Drug Rehabilitation and Detox for Withdrawal Symptoms

One of the reasons drug addicted people find it difficult to stop using drugs once they start using them, is because of physical and psychological dependency that inevitably develops if the person uses drugs long enough. It no longer becomes a matter of "willpower" because their bodies and minds will actually produce extremely u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ms when they try to stop using drugs. This is called drug withdrawal, and is a major roadblock for people who want to stop using drugs. Individuals often fall extremely ill during withdrawal and can even die in in some cases, because seizures and strokes can occur with certain drugs and with alcohol. Depression is a very typical withdrawal symptom, which can become so severe that the person may commit suicide.

To ease certain withdrawal symptoms and to make detox a safer process, it is important that drug addicted individuals who wish to quit do so in the proper environment such as a drug rehabilitation facility. Drug rehabilitation centers in Wilcoe can not only see individuals safely through the detox process and help alleviate and relieve withdrawal symptoms, but also ensure that the person doesn't relapse back into drug use. After detox has been accomplished, addiction professionals in Wilcoe will then ensure that all underlying psychological and emotional issues tied to the person's addiction are confronted and resolved so that they stay off of drugs once they leave the drug rehabilitation program.

Drug Addiction and the Enabler

It is not uncommon in most cases of addiction in Wilcoe that the individual's habit is influenced entirely or partially by a person who is connected to them in some way. An enabler is either a knowing or unaware participant in the persons struggle with drug addiction, and is someone who makes their addiction possible or easier to prolong. The act of enabling is often carried out out of "concern" or "worry", but does more damage than good in the end. A good example of an enabler is a family member or partner who gives an addicted individual any kind of financing, housing, transportation, and may even obtain the individual's drug for them. The logic behind this is often that the enabling is helping the person to be in a safe and stable scenario, rather than being on the streets or in harmful situations.

Enablers are frequently the crucial component in an addicted persons life which is actually making the drug addiction possible. Reversely, enablers can also be the key to helping someone get off of drugs by discontinuing the enabling behaviors. As soon as the enabling has been stopped, the addict will often realize that it is no longer possible to continue their habit and will reach a crisis point. This is why an enabler must recognize the situation immediately and instead of prolonging the individual's addiction, get them into an effective drug treatment facility in Wilcoe. Only then will both the enabler and the drug addict be able to go on with their lives in a much healthier and sane manner.

What is the Process of Drug Rehab

Whatever drug rehab option in Wilcoe is chosen, the process of drug rehab almost always begins with a drug detox. Drug detoxification is often overseen with medical professionals and trained personnel at the detoxification center or drug rehabilitation center. Treatment staff will help ease withdrawal symptoms during the detoxification period and make this step of the process as smooth and comfortable as possible. Individuals going through drug withdrawal will often have extreme cravings for their drug or drugs or choice and relapse if likely if not in a drug treatment setting

After the physical hurdles have been overcome, the next steps of the process of drug rehab include addressing any and all underlying emotional and psychological issues. This can be very different from person to person, and most drug rehab facilities incorporate behavioral therapy as well as group and individualized counseling to ensure that all issues are resolved. This will ensure that the individual is able to remain clean and sober once treatment is complete. Part of the process of drug rehab is ensuring that the individual is set up for success once treatment is complete, and treatment counselors will often develop aftercare programs with the individual to make certain they remain clean and sober for the long term.

How Much Does a Drug Rehab Facility Cost?

It can be difficult enough to get someone to want help and agree to enter a drug rehab facility in Wilcoe. Finding the money to pay for drug rehab can often be a challenge, but one that can be overcome if one considers the many possibilities available in Wilcoe. Depending on which drug rehabilitation option is selected, the cost of drug rehabilitation can vary considerably from program to program. Some outpatient and short term drug rehab facilitiescenters]]] for example may be state or federally funded and may even be free of charge. These types of programs are also typically the least effective however, a fact which should be considered over cost.

More long term drug rehabilitation programs in Wilcoe which have proven to be the most effective are residential and inpatient drug treatment programs which require a stay of at least 90 days. These types of drug rehabilitation programs are usually more expensive due to the fact that these facilities are private drug rehab facilities and supply their clients with all food and shelter for the duration of their stay. These programs typically cost anywhere from $4000 to $20,000, depending on the length of stay and the amenities offered.
